Great Western Railway is a train operating company in the United Kingdom. It operates services from London Paddington to the West of England, South Wales and the Cotswolds. It also operates services from London Paddington to Oxford, Reading and Bristol. It offers a range of ticket types, including Advance, Anytime, Off-Peak and Super Off-Peak tickets. Onboard facilities include free Wi-Fi, power sockets, air conditioning and catering services. The most popular routes for Great Western Railway are London Paddington to Bristol, Reading and Oxford.

The distance between Barnstaple and Exeter is approximately 33 miles (54 km) and the average train journey duration is 55m. Plan your trip effortlessly, ensuring a smooth travel experience.
Trains from Barnstaple to Exeter run frequently, with approximately 17 services operating daily. This robust schedule is maintained throughout the week, providing reliable travel options from Monday to Sunday.
Start your day early or enjoy a later departure with the convenience of our train schedule. The first train to Exeter typically departs at 00:07, with the final service leaving Barnstaple at 18:32. Check the Barnstaple to Exeter train schedule to find a time that suits your travel needs.
Passengers board the train most frequently from Barnstaple, which is located around 0.7 miles (1.1 km) away from the city centre, and they get off the train at Exeter St Davids, located 1.9 miles (3 km) away from the city centre.
